Meghan Markle and Prince Harry were amongst several upbeat and happy fans on Saturday at the Invictus Games in Australia, where the parents-to-be cheered some major games on from the sidelines.
HRH greeted several members of various wheelchair basketball teams competing in the games final, where England won their third bronze medal match against New Zealand while the Netherlands and the U.S. competed in the gold medal game.
The excitement was clear on many of the players faces who were happy to get a moment with the Duchess of Sussex after they competed in their riveting games.
